As the primary component of the amyloid plaques seen in the brains of Alzheimer patients, amyloid- (A) refers to peptides of 36–43 amino acids that are crucially involved in Alzheimer's disease. The amyloid precursor protein (APP), which is cut by specific enzymes to produce A, produces the peptides. Amyloid molecules can group together to create a variety of flexible, soluble oligomers.A amyloid-peptide buildup results from excessive A production or malfunctioning clearance mechanisms. Amyloid- forms diffuse and neuritic plaques in the parenchyma and blood vessels by self-aggregating into oligomers of various sizes. Strong synaptotoxins, proteasome inhibition, mitochondrial inhibition, alteration of intracellular Ca2+ levels, and induction of inflammatory processes are all characteristics of amyloid-oligomers and plaques. Neuronal dysfunction is also thought to be influenced by the loss of A's typical physiological functions.
